
Akmola freight transportation department formed five grain export routes in January. As part of this work, attention is paid to organizing routes in the direction of Central Asia, China and the port of Aktau, the press service of the national company reported.
According to KTZ, in January, Akmola railway workers transported 696.7 thousand tons of cargo, including 512.8 thousand tons of grain (7,478 cars). Of the total volume, 94.1 thousand tons were transported within the country, and 418.6 thousand tons were exported.
The Ministry of Agriculture of the Republic of Kazakhstan reported that 5.3 million tons of new crop grain have been exported in Kazakhstan since September, and another 1.4 million tons have been transported within the country. Export volumes in the current season have increased by 48.3%.
In particular, 2 million tons (+34.9%) were sent to Uzbekistan, 789 thousand tons (+47%) to Tajikistan, 679 thousand tons to China, and 235 thousand tons (+37%) to Afghanistan. Deliveries to Iran increased 20 times and reached 644 thousand tons, and to Azerbaijan - 79 times, up to 319 thousand tons. In addition, 352 thousand tons of flour were transported in January and 16 days of February, including 238 thousand tons of exports. In 2024, 2.4 million tons of flour were exported, with an increase of 3% compared to the previous year. The main countries importing flour are Central Asian countries, China, Afghanistan and others.
